Beverly Lou Savage

July 15, 1938 — April 29, 2024

Zanesville

Beverly Lou Savage, 85, of Zanesville passed away peacefully on April 29, 2024 at Adams Lane Care Center and under the care of Genesis Hospice.

Beverly was born in Zanesville on July 15, 1938. She is the daughter of Charles Douglas “Doug” and Doris H. (Morey) Sparkman. She previously worked as the manager of various restaurants in the Columbus area for over 55 years. She loved animals and enjoyed caring for her furry friends.  She was a Zanesville High School graduate and a lifetime member of the George Selsam VFW Post # 1058. She is survived by her husband, James “Jim” Savage, whom she married February 7, 1998; her children Lloyd Jordan, Christopher (Wyndy) Bunting, Shawn Noll, Melanie Von Gunten and Roma (Travis) Howes.  Beverly is also survived by 19 grandchildren and 16 great grandchildren. In addition to her parents, Beverly is preceded in death by her first husband, David Boyer, who passed away in 1996; three grandsons, Scott Allen Bunting, Christopher Michael Bunting, and Charles Killian Bunting; a granddaughter, Sarah Beverly Bunting-McKelvey; and son-in-law, Daniel J. Von Gunten. She was Catholic by faith.

Private family services will be held with Fr. Ondrey officiating. Beverly will be laid to rest in Zanesville Memorial Park cemetery.
